Understanding Key Fobs

What is a Key Fob?

A key fob is a cordless gadget that interacts with an automobile's electronic system. It normally includes buttons for locking and unlocking the doors, opening the trunk, and starting the engine. Key fobs make use of radio frequency signals to communicate with the car, offering a safe and hassle-free approach of entry.

Why Replace Your Ford Key Fob?

There are a number of reasons that a Ford automobile owner might require to replace a key fob:

  1. Loss or Theft: Losing the key fob can cause prospective security issues.
  2. Damage: Physical damage due to use and tear or mishaps can hinder functionality.
  3. Battery Failure: If the battery is dead and the fob can not be changed, a new fob is necessary.
  4. Malfunction: Internal electronic failures can render the key fob unusable.
  5. Update: Owners might wish to upgrade to a newer model fob for added features.

Programming Your New Key Fob

Programming a new Ford key fob varies based upon the kind of fob and the design of the car. Some fobs can be configured by the owner, while others need expert help. Here is a list of basic steps for self-programming:

  1. Insert the Original Key: Insert your working key into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position without starting the engine.
  2. Cycle the Key: Turn it off and on once again numerous times, normally within 10 seconds.
  3. Get rid of the Key: Turn the ignition off and remove the key.
  4. Insert the New Fob: Insert the new key fob into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position.
  5. Press the Lock Button: Press the lock button repeatedly to register the new key.

Crucial: Not all fobs can be programmed by doing this. Always consult your lorry's manual for specific directions.

Regularly Asked Questions about Ford Key Fobs

1. How do I know if my key fob is suitable with my Ford lorry?

Response: You can check your owner's handbook or seek advice from a Ford dealership to determine compatibility between the key fob and your car design.

2. Can I utilize a used key fob for my Ford lorry?

Response: Yes, however it should be reprogrammed to match your lorry's electronic system. Not all used fobs are ensured to work.

3. How can I tell if my key fob battery is dead?

Response: Symptoms of a dead key fob battery include a reduced range or the failure to unlock or start your vehicle.

4. What should I do if my key fob is lost?

Response: If you lose your key fob, it's crucial to change it as quickly as possible to prevent security concerns. Also, think about reprogramming the system if necessary.

5. How long do key fob batteries last?

Response: Generally, key fob batteries last 3-4 years. However, usage and environmental elements may impact their lifespan.
